Transaction 69ad83fd43cf8dfd1d36173bc3ba802e396a07c303b0fcdb01ecce7e971ea0bb

block
2aab5968cff423d003ca6a4cb60a53b1bbbf574c09785c03e65fabd1c9c15507

1 Input

23 Outputs